ZIP code 73550 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 558.2 square miles in Hollis, Harmon County, Oklahoma. The area is home to 2,512 residents, producing a population density of 5 people per square mile, and falls within the Chicago time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 73550 against Oklahoma and the nation.

On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 73550 sits at $43,804 (30% below the Oklahoma average), while per-capita income is $28,264. The poverty rate stands at 24.7% and the unemployment rate at 7.7%. On housing, the median home value is $80,200 (49% below the state average) with median rent at $697 per month, and 67.0%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 73550 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.

Education and household profile round out the picture: 12.2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 38.7, and the average commute is 18 minutes. What businesses operate in this ZIP?

Census Bureau data shows 46 business establishments in ZIP 73550, employing approximately 337 people with a combined annual payroll of $14,615,000.
